FinOps Specialist Salary by Seniority Level

Seniority is the biggest single driver of FinOps Specialist pay in United Arab Emirates. Entry-level roles start at AED30K, rising 180% to AED84K at lead or principal level.

Why FinOps Specialist Salaries Are at This Level

FinOps Specialists in United Arab Emirates earn a median salary of AED43K/mo in 2026, with a typical range from AED42K at the 25th percentile to AED43K at the 75th percentile. This benchmark reflects published market compensation data for monthly pay across the United Arab Emirates market.

Dubai currently leads city pay at AED43K/mo, which is 0% below the national benchmark. City coverage for this role includes Abu Dhabi, Dubai, helping you compare local pay differences without needing separate city-role pages.

At experience level, entry roles start around AED30K/mo, senior roles sit near AED61K/mo, and lead-level roles reach about AED84K/mo. Demand is currently moderate for this role based on recent coverage and salary momentum signals.

Is a AED43K/mo FinOps Specialist hybrid role worth the commute in the UAE?

On a 3-day hybrid schedule with a typical the UAE commute (AED 14/day travel, 60-minute round trip, daily meal premium, annual wardrobe costs), your true net income at AED43K/mo is approximately AED 474,929 per year, compared to AED 516,000 net without any commute. The commute costs AED 41,071 per year in direct expenses and lost time. A fully remote role paying AED 475,000 would leave you equally well off.

7

What remote salary is equivalent to a AED43K/mo hybrid FinOps Specialist salary in the UAE?

Assuming a 3-day hybrid schedule with typical commute costs, you would need a remote salary of at least AED 475,000 to match the true net value of a AED43K/mo hybrid FinOps Specialist role in the UAE. For a 5-day fully in-office role, the break-even remote salary rises to AED 447,800, as the higher office frequency increases travel, meal, and time costs significantly.
